To find the closest distance a person who rode the original Ferris wheel travelled in one complete revolution, we can use the formula for the circumference of a circle.

The circumference of a circle is calculated using the formula: C = π * d, where C is the circumference and d is the diameter.

In this case, the diameter of the Ferris wheel is given as 250 feet. So, we can find the circumference:

C = π * 250 = 785.4 feet (rounded to one decimal place)

Therefore, when a person rides the original Ferris wheel and completes one full revolution, they would have traveled a distance of approximately 785.4 feet (rounded to one decimal place).
